Is Peanut Butter A Low Carb Food?
The answer to this question depends on the brand and type of peanut butter you’re eating. While peanut butter itself is relatively low in carbohydrates, some brands may contain added sugars or other ingredients that increase the carb count. Additionally, some types of peanut butter, such as those with added honey or chocolate, will also be higher in carbs.
For those following a strict low-carb diet, it’s important to read labels carefully and choose a peanut butter that fits within your daily carb allowance. Look for natural peanut butter without added sugars, or consider making your own at home.
What is the Lowest Carb Peanut Butter?
We’ve done some research and found that the lowest carb peanut butter on the market is typically natural, unsweetened peanut butter. Some popular brands include Smucker’s Natural Peanut Butter, Crazy Richard’s 100% Peanuts All Natural Peanut Butter, and Trader Joe’s Organic Creamy No Salt Peanut Butter. These brands all contain around 2 grams of net carbs per serving (which is usually 2 tablespoons).
If you’re looking for a lower-calorie option, powdered peanut butter can be a good choice. Powdered peanut butter typically has fewer calories and carbs than traditional peanut butter because it’s made by removing the oil from roasted peanuts. However, keep in mind that powdered peanut butter often contains added sugars to make up for the lost flavor from the oil, so be sure to read labels carefully.
While peanut butter can be a delicious and satisfying addition to any diet, it’s important to keep portion sizes in mind. Even low-carb peanut butter can be high in calories and fat, so be sure to measure out your servings carefully. Using peanut butter as a dip for celery or carrots, or adding a small amount to your morning smoothie, are both great ways to enjoy this tasty spread without going overboard.
